Why Hydroponics Greenhouses are a Good Idea
68
Commonly, when people decide to start growing plants hydroponically, they will set up a system wherever they have some extra space, such as the basement. Obviously, though, most people aren't interested in letting their hydroponic garden invade their homes! That's why many people who are committed to hydroponics will look into purchasing or building hydroponics greenhouses.
Growing your plants in hydroponics greenhouses is preferable in a number of ways to just setting them up in an unused area of your home. In a greenhouse, it is much easier to maintain just the right conditions for a growing garden. Temperature, ventilation and lighting are all easier to control. Also, a hydroponic garden will require systems for irrigation and hydroponic lights which require adequate room to install. A greenhouse makes it possible to locate this equipment where it will be most beneficial. This is critical, because regulation of water and light are more important in hydroponics than in a regular garden.
The most important benefit of hydroponics greenhouses has to do with the light. When you grow plants hydroponically, it's essential that they get adequate amounts of light. However, it's also important to remember that too much direct light allows algae to grow and that is not beneficial. In a greenhouse setting, daylight is filtered and diffused naturally. Shades and shutters will regulate the quantity of light as well as the angle at which it enters the structure. Less energy consumption is another advantage as grow lights won't need to be continually lit up.
Owning a greenhouse will make the installation and maintenance of your nutrient delivery system easier. This is crucial to how well your hydroponic specimens grow and thrive. Because your garden isn't soil based, the pH level is more likely to fluctuate. As alkalinity and acidity are water based, it's quite common for their levels to range widely. It is easy to set up an automatic system to control the pH levels in a greenhouse. Hence, you are not continually checking the levels.
The temperature reading is also crucial in terms of hydroponic gardening. You will be able to keep heaters at bay when a greenhouse is well constructed as it does a decent job at maintaining the temperature. This is especially beneficial if you live somewhere that gets cold but has lots of sun. You can also install air vents and fans to regulate the temperature in your greenhouse even more precisely.
While many hydroponics greenhouses can be purchased in packages, you also have the option of building one of your own. The scope of the available models and sizes is quite large. Should your hydroponic garden become larger you can add on to many of the greenhouse packages that are available. These are convincing reasons to consider building a greenhouse to showcase your hydroponic garden.
